the battery supply, taking up little room so that the whole thing is very portable along with my portable headphone amp. The voltage to the dac also needs to be increased to almost 6 volts from the stock 4.9 to really sing.I can plug in a wall wart, charge the batteries and listen to the unit at the same time or just use the wall wart.
